Secret Life Of The Tasmanian Devil

Tasmanian devils are the bruisers of the animal kingdom: feisty, fearless, and always up for a fight. But despite being at the top of the food chain, these marsupials face extinction due to a deadly disease they pass on to one another through biting. Join conservationists as they step into the turf of this brawling ball of ferocity, in a bid to rescue them from themselves.

Real Life in the Zoo

The animals play the main role in this series. The animals are the real main characters and the supporting roles are for the caretakers or zoo staff. Decisive for the program is the camera technology, which shows the animals' lives everywhere behind the scenes and out of sight of the audience. We experience the 24-hour feeling within the walls of the zoo, just like the animals themselves. The program is recorded at Ouwehands Zoo in Rhenen, the Netherlands.
